Scentbird Review - December 2016

Scentbird is a monthly fragrance subscription service. Each month you will receive an 8 ml purse spray (enough perfume to apply daily for a whole month) of any fragrance of your choice. Your first month will also include a custom perfume atomizer to protect your perfume. Scentbird has over 450 fragrances to choose from, but if you don’t make a selection, they will send you their monthly featured scent.

Scentbird ships on the 15th of the month.  If you subscribe before the 5th of the month, your package will ship on the 15th of that month. If you subscribe after the 5th, your package will ship the following month.

Each month Scentbird selects a perfume of the month.  You are free to choose from their selection of fragrances or you can opt for the Scent of the Month.

I opted for Pinrose Wild Child which was the December 2016 Scentbird Scent of the Month:

~Pinrose Wild Child: Wild Child is a “flirty blend of jasmine and gardenia”.  It wasn’t quite as floral as I was expecting though.  It wasn’t a heavy floral and the scent didn’t last long at all.  It seemed a bit strong at first, settled nicely and then was gone after an hour or so.  My feelings are mixed on this one. I wouldn’t buy a full-size bottle of this I know that.
